running, running, running...
looking forward towards the finish line,
never looking back.
Passing the crowd, the roaring crowed, the crowd with no faces.
Suddenly; silence.
In slow motion the untidy mass of laces connive with gravity...
falling fast forward
hands out
gasping with the reality of what should never happen,
my last glance was of the many fast feet passing by.
The roar of sound came back as my body skidded over gravel and blade
grass green mixing with red blood
upon my face was shame
upon my lips held tightly the grimace of pain.
Ahead, the ribbon was broken by those who never stumbled.
1st
2nd
3rd
4th
...
I walked from my world in tears
I ran from the place
never to finish what I always started
living in a self-imposed disgrace,
knowing now I could never again finish first or second or any other place;
for me the race of life left my body that day,
the race was finally finished.
